Enzymes and Probiotics Provide Dual Action Digestive Support


Enzymedica EnzymesThere’s been a lot of talk lately about probiotics and the ways they benefit the body.  Probiotics are the healthy flora that reside in the digestive tract.  Traditionally, probiotics were consumed through cultured foods like cheese and yogurt and fermented beverages like kefir.  Today, dietary supplements containing probiotics are some of the most popular products on the shelf.

The condition and function of the gastrointestinal tract is essential to overall health.  This condition is highly dependent on the presence of billions of probiotic cultures which support regularity, aid the immune system, and produce vitamins like B and K.  These healthy microflora protect us against the overgrowth of already present, potentially pathogenic organisms in the gut.  They also fuel digestion through the production of enzymes such as lactase, protease, and amylase.  As an added bonus, the enzymes made by the flora work synergistically with the body’s inherent enzymes to support digestive health and optimal wellbeing.


Probiotics are active cultures which must make their way through various obstacles in their journey to the gastrointestinal tract.  First, they must stand up to exposure to light, heat, and moisture on the shelf. After consumption, they must withstand harsh stomach acid and other digestive fluids.  Key to the efficacy of a probiotic supplement is product stability, both on the shelf and inside the intestinal tract.
